14. NEW ZEALAND CONSUMER LEGISLATION
14.1 Consumer Guarantees Act 1993
The Consumer Guarantees Act sets out minimum standards for goods sold in New Zealand. In the event that goods sold are not of acceptable quality or are faulty, the customer has the right to a replacement or refund, subject to the terms of that Act. Where you are purchasing goods for business purposes, you agree that the Consumer Guarantees Act 1993 does not apply, to the extent permitted by section 2(2) of that Act.
14.2 Fair Trading Act 1986
The Fair Trading Act is designed to protect customers from being misled, either intentionally or unintentionally. This applies to all aspects of the promotion and sale of goods and services including pricing, product origin, safety standards, availability, and sales techniques. The Commerce Commission enforces the Fair Trading Act 1986.
